Episode 132 - Juneteenth reflections: lessons and legends from the Negro Leagues
We begin this week by discussing the life and legacy of Willie Mays, and then we dive more fully into what the significance of the Negro Leagues was then and is now and discuss how baseball, in particular, and sports in general, often serve as a microcosm for the country. We wrap up by highlighting two Negro League greats.
